Hello, I started using EasyEDA just a couple of weeks ago and I totally love it. I usually work on a mac and noticed that your autorouter is compiled for win64 and linux64 only. This is not a showstopper for me, but I always have to start a windows or linux machine just for routing (don't want to bother your routing server when it routes locally so well). Could You also compile a binary for the Mac please ? Bye, Torsten...

Have you tried the Linux one? The autorouter is a java program that is started with a shell script. The startup script might work in your shell.
